The options for this question are:

A) calm and cool.

B) rough and stormy.

C) smooth and silky.

D) cruel and bloodthirsty.

Answer: D) cruel and bloodthirsty.

Step-by-step explanation: the tone of a story, a poem, a paragraph or even a sentence, is the author's or speaker's attitude towards the subject, the audience or the characters of the text. The tone of a text is expressed by the author's word choices, in this case, the given words (dead, blood, treacherous, savage, prey, murdered, and strangled) are used to create a negative tone, and a picture of the ocean that is cruel and bloodthirsty.
